  • the invention relates to a health management system, in particular to a health management service system and a method thereof, which are formed by connecting a mobile phone or a personal computer to a server via the Internet.
  • mobile phones With the popularity of mobile smart phones (hereinafter referred to as "mobile phones"), the use of mobile phones to provide health information management services is increasingly occupying the market today. Therefore, the Internet-based connection communication platform makes mobile phones more prominent in people's health management and services. For example, a user accesses an Internet server through a mobile phone, inputs dietary, obesity, blood pressure, and blood sugar, as well as personal information related to human health, analyzes it, and analyzes the resulting food, exercise information, and health through a mobile phone. Status information, etc., provided to the user.
  • the existing method for providing such health information is that when the user accesses the Internet server through the mobile phone and inputs the detailed personal data related to the human health information, the corresponding data of the database is analyzed and matched. Information such as food information of personal physique, exercise and health status required to maintain health is provided to the user via a mobile phone, but the user can perform health management. but
  • the prior art human health service system is a comprehensive health management service provided by a general, such as a sub-health population, and cannot be serviced for a specific case, such as a person suffering from a disease.
  • the main purpose of the present invention is to provide a health management service system, in particular, a health management service system capable of satisfying general and specific populations by using a mobile phone or a personal computer to connect with a server via the Internet. .

  • a health management service system created by the present invention includes a daily meal unit 10 and a healthcare unit 20, and provides information to the server 40 by a portable scanning terminal (such as a mobile phone) 30.
  • Mobile phone 30 supports wireless network connections, where:
  • the daily meal unit 10 is electronically managed by a bar code function, including a food barcode 11, a water glass barcode 12 and a beverage barcode 13 , wherein the food barcode 11 is a barcode provided on the food packaging bag, and is also a human body.
  • the bar code 12 is a bar code attached to the cup, and is also a basis for measuring the amount of water absorbed by the human body in a day;
  • the bar code 13 is a mark with weight and energy on the bottle. Bar code is also the basis for measuring how much drink a human body drinks a day.
  • the health care unit 20 like the daily meal unit 10, is also electronically managed by a bar code function, including a blood pressure bar code 21, a blood glucose bar code 22 and a drug bar code 23, and a toilet bar code 24, wherein the blood pressure bar code 21 is The blood pressure result measured by the sphygmomanometer is converted into bar code data; the blood glucose bar code 22 is converted into bar code data by the blood glucose measuring instrument to measure blood sugar; the drug bar code 23 records a bar code for each time of taking the drug, the dose of the drug, the function, and the method of taking;
  • the toilet bar code 24 refers to a smart toilet that can automatically measure the weight of the user before going to the toilet and the weight after the toilet is finished, and the record of the condition of the toilet; in the embodiment of the invention, the health care unit 20 further includes Sports barcode 25, The exercise bar code 25 records the time distance, the sporting item, and the time of walking each day.
  • the mobile phone 30 includes a communication unit 31, a display unit 32, a memory unit 33, an identification unit 34, an operation unit 35, and a control unit 36, wherein the user can input personal information through the operation unit 35.
  • the registered member may also input information (such as food type, ingredient content, etc.) of the food to be ingested;
  • the identification unit 34 may read or edit the barcode information;
  • the communication unit 31 transmits and receives data to and from the Internet via the mobile phone 30;
  • the display The unit 31 is a visual platform for presenting input information, reading barcode information or transmitting and receiving information;
  • the memory unit 33 may store the above information, and transmit relevant barcode information to the server 40, and management information related to daily diet and medical care;
  • the control unit 36 analyzes the ingested food information, the health check and the medication, and the exercise information input by the user based on the health management information, and obtains the heat of the currently ingested food and the daily required calories, and the current Check, medication data and standard data necessary
  • the server 40 includes a database unit 41, a communication unit 42, and a processor unit 43, wherein the database unit 41 includes registered user information 411, human health information 412, and recipe information 413, and diseases.
  • the related menu material 414 further includes food nutrition information 415, food ingredient information 416, and other information 417 related to health and disease;
  • the communication unit 42 communicates with the communication unit 31 of the mobile phone 30 via the Internet, and receives the mobile phone.
  • the processor unit 43 calculates and analyzes the user information 431 and the general human health management information 432, the body health
  • the management information 432 includes a human body condition 4321, a recipe intake status 4322, and a sports condition 4323;
  • the database unit 41 further includes data 418 of the user's daily intake of food energy, and data 419 of the energy consumed by the user's exercise.
  • the application method of the health management service system created by the invention has the following steps:
  • the user's daily meal class 10 and the health care class 20 scan or input the edited data through a portable scanning terminal (such as a mobile phone) 30 by using a barcode attached to the package or the container, or data of human health detected by a special tool. .
  • a portable scanning terminal such as a mobile phone
  • the user sets the connection with the server 40 using the operation unit 35 of the mobile phone 30.
  • the communication unit 31 will be commanded by the control unit 36 to connect with the server 40 via the Internet.
  • the user inputs his/her personal information through the operation unit 35 and uploads it to the server 40 to register the member.
  • Personal information entered for registered members includes ID, password, name, gender, ID number, date of birth, body characteristics, dietary information, member date, and description of the disease.
  • body characteristics include height, weight, blood type, vision, waist circumference, etc.
  • dietary information includes favorite foods, foods that are frequently eaten, number of meals a day, and average sleep time.
  • the personal information submission server 40 analyzes, at this time, the user's health management information recovered by the mobile phone 30;
  • the server 40 determines the physique and body shape of the user by analyzing the body shape information and the diet information input by the user, and formulates a menu suitable for the user's health state, which reflects the specific food shape in which the body shape and the physique should be restricted. Returning the above physique, body shape, menu and overall food information to the mobile phone 30;
  • the mobile phone 30 uploads the user's health information within a certain period, it analyzes this and periodically and weekly (periodically or monthlyly) formulates menu information for uploading to the server 40.
  • the food information is provided separately according to the type of food, such as fruits, meat, vegetables, etc.;
  • the server 40 establishes the user's health management database unit 41 based on the disease-related information, the recipe information, and the component information of the food, and the menu information of various diseases, and the database unit 41 reflects the personal data of the registered member user, such as Whether there are diseases, body shapes, eating habits, etc.;
  • the control unit 36 When the mobile phone 30 receives health management information reflecting the user's health status, such as body shape, physique, menu, food, etc., from the server 40, the control unit 36 will store it in the memory unit 33.
  • control unit 36 analyzes the food information and the intake amount with reference to the health management information stored in the memory unit 33, and calculates the food ingested by the user.
  • the heat and the daily required heat are again presented by the display unit 32.
  • the process of inputting the food information and the intake amount may be selectively performed by the user, or may be further set by the mobile phone 30 in the already displayed periodic display information, such as a warning reminder, etc. matter.
  • the calorie of the food ingested by the user or the food to be ingested is displayed by Kcal according to the type of the food.
  • control unit 36 when analyzing the food information and the intake amount input by the user, the control unit 36 confirms that the food contains the food (or ingredient) that the user should restrict to ingest, and displays it in the display unit 32 with the audible warning reminding function. This does not allow the user to ingest foods that are restricted.
  • the information analyzed every day will be stored in the memory unit 33 by date, respectively, and the control unit 36 confirms that it is stored in a certain period (per cycle or monthly).
  • the analysis information in the memory unit 33 is then determined, and the user's health management success degree is determined, and the related information is presented to the display unit 33 for the user to know.
  • the mobile phone 30 will transmit all of the analysis information to the server 40 within a certain period to update the health management data of the user established on the server 40.
  • the server 40 will redefine the health management information provided to the user, such as the menu, the amount of exercise, etc., so as to conform to the current state of the user's health, and then transmit it to the mobile phone 30.
  • the user can manage his or her health every day by confirming the health management information stored in the mobile phone 30, adjusting the food intake, and increasing or decreasing the amount of exercise.

Abstract

L'invention concerne un système de service de gestion de santé et un procédé associé. Le système de service de gestion de santé comprend une unité de régime alimentaire quotidien et une unité de soins médicaux, et un téléphone cellulaire qui fournit des informations à un serveur au moyen d'un terminal de balayage portable, le téléphone cellulaire prenant en charge des connexions réseau sans fil. L'unité de régime alimentaire quotidien effectue une gestion électronique au moyen d'une fonction de code-barres comprenant un code-barres d'aliment, un code-barres de verre d'eau et un code-barres de boisson. L'unité de soins médicaux comprend un code-barres de pression sanguine, un code-barres de glycémie, un code-barres de médicament et un code-barres de toilette. Le téléphone cellulaire comprend une unité de communication, une unité d'affichage, une unité de mémoire, une unité d'identification, une unité de fonctionnement et une unité de commande. Le serveur comprend une unité de base de données, une unité de communication ou une unité de processeur. Sur la base de ces conceptions structurelles et des étapes d'applications associées, un système de services de gestion de santé qui se connecte à un serveur via Internet au moyen d'un téléphone cellulaire ou d'un ordinateur personnel et un procédé associé sont obtenus.
